EG-CT-1 - Access to New Site VM resources

First determine orca_version running at this aggregate:

$ omni -a umass-eg getversion

Created a slice and then created a 4 VMs sliver using the RSpec EG-CT-1.rspec

$ omni createslice EG-CT-1
$ omni createsliver -a umass-eg EG-CT-1 EG-CT-1.rspec 

Determine login information:

$ readyToLogin -a umass-eg EG-CT-1

EG-CT-2 - Access to New Site bare metal and VM resources

Create a slice:

$ omni createslice EG-CT-2

}}} Create a sliver with one VM and one bare metal node using RSpec EG-CT-2.rspec. Note: Bare metal only available via ExoSM.

$ omni createsliver EG-CT-2 -a eg-sm ./EG-CT-2.rspec 

}}}

Determine login information:

$ readyToLogin EG-CT-2 -a eg-sm
